ASP.NET Core Minimal API Development Full Build

Why take this course?
🌟 Course Title: ASP.NET Core Minimal API Development Full Build
🚀 Headline: Learn a new and modern way to build a RESTful API using ASP.NET Core's Minimal API engine and Entity Framework, while adopting enterprise-level development practices and patterns.
🔍 Why Learn ASP.NET Core / .NET 6 / .NET 7? Microsoft .NET is the backbone of business technology for top corporations across the globe. It's a stable, mature, and fast platform that has proven its scalability and reliability. Learning ASP.NET Core Web API development is essential for modern web developers to extend their software's accessibility and create more global solutions.
🏗️ Build A Strong Foundation in .NET Programming: This course will guide you through the process of building a full data-driven REST Web API using the latest technology, ensuring you cover all the essentials:
- 🛠️ Test and Troubleshoot using Postman and Swagger
- 🗂️ Create a database with Entity Framework Core
- 🌍 Setup Logging with Serilog
- 📖 API documentation using SwaggerUI
- 🚀 Understand the REST design principles
- ☕ C# 11 and .NET Core Web Syntax
- 🔒 User Authentication with Identity Core and JWT (JSON Web Tokens)
- 🔄 Implement Refresh Token Endpoint
- 📱 Use Data Transfer Objects (DTOs) and AutoMapper
- ✅ Integrate Fluent Validations
- 🚫 Manage Packages with NuGet Manager
- 💨 API Caching and Request Rate Throttling
- ⏱️ HTTP Request Filters
- 📊 Understand .NET 6 / .NET 7 workflows, tools, and application development
📚 PREREQUISITES: To enroll in this course, you should have at least 3 months of experience programming in C#. If you're new to C# or need to refresh your skills, consider taking the prerequisite course: "C# Console and Windows Forms Development with LINQ & ADO .NET."
🎓 Content and Overview: This is an intermediate-level course designed for those who have knowledge of Object-Oriented Programming. Even if you're new to the .NET development stack, this beginner-friendly course will cover best practices and efficient logic step by step. You'll apply your skills through practical exercises and troubleshooting.
🛠️ Hands-On Learning: Over 8 hours of premium content is carefully structured to highlight related activities as you build an application module by module. You'll find working files hosted on GitHub to assist you, and upon completion, you'll receive a verifiable certificate of achievement.
💼 Career Advancement: By completing this course, you'll not only increase your income potential but also demonstrate your skills to impress your boss and coworkers.
💰 Satisfaction Guarantee: We stand by the quality of our content. If you find that this course doesn't meet your expectations within 30 days of purchase, we offer a no-questions-asked refund.
🆕 Take Action Now! Don't miss out on this opportunity to enhance your skills and become an expert in ASP.NET Core Minimal API Development. Click the "Take This Course" button and embark on a journey that could significantly elevate your career.
🤝 See you in the course! Let's build something amazing together! 🚀🎉
Loading charts...